c언어 프로그래밍 printf() 특수문자
c언어 프로그래밍 printf() 특수문자 ■ c언어에서 모니터에 어떤 문자열을 출력하기 위해서는 printf() 함수를 이용하고 이 함수를 호출하면서 매개변수에 "출력될 내용"을 큰 따옴표("") 사이에 넣어서 전달하면 되는데요. 저 같은 초보님들을 위해서 예제를 만들면서 정리하겠습니다. ▲ 단순하게 printf()를 호출하면서 출력할 문자열을 큰따옴표 사이에 넣어서 입력했습니다. 프로그램을 실행해보겠습니다. ▲ 이렇게 큰따옴표 안에 있는 문자열이 출력되는데요. 그렇다면 (" ") 자체를 출력하려면 어떻게 해야 할까요? 다음과 같이 하면 될까요? ▲ 제가 표현하고 싶은 문자열은 ["철수야" 학교자가]입니다. 위 예제처럼 입력하면 가능한지 컴파일을 진행해보겠습니다. ▲ 예상하셨겠지만 이렇게 큰따옴표를 식..
c언어 printf 정수 서식문자
c언어 printf 정수 서식 문자 ■ 지난 글에서 c언어 프로그램의 함수의 구조를 간단하게 살펴보고 hello world를 출력해봤는데 c언어에서 문자열을 화면에 출력하기 위해서 printf() 함수를 사용했다. ▲ 앞 예제에서는 큰 따옴표 안의 문자열만을 출력하고 있지만 이번글에서는 10진수 정수를 출력하는 서식 문자에 대해서 알아보도록 한다. 먼저 정수를 출력하는 예제를 만들어본다. ▲ printf() 함수에 전달된 인자와 출력된 내용을 비교해보면 좀 더 쉽게 이해가 된다. (큰따옴표 안의 마지막 '\n'은 개행을 의미하는 이스케이프 시퀀시(escape sequence)로써 출력은 되지 않고 줄만 개행하게 된다.) 1. 첫 번째는 큰따옴표 안에 출력될 문자열 hello world를 전달하고 있는 모..